Typical Sorts Of Concrete Foundations
When it involves building foundations, understanding the common kinds of concrete structures can assist you make informed selections for your task. The most prevalent kinds include slab-on-grade, crawl area, and complete basement foundations.A slab-on-grade structure is a simple, affordable option, where a thick concrete piece is poured directly on the ground. This type functions well in cozy environments, as it reduces heat loss.Crawl area structures raise the home somewhat over ground, permitting ventilation and accessibility to plumbing and electrical systems. This style can assist protect against wetness issues.Full cellar foundations offer extra living or storage room while giving outstanding structural assistance. They need more excavation and are usually made use of in cooler environments to stop frost heave.

Support Methods Discussed
As soon as the site is appropriately prepared, the next action in assuring a durable concrete foundation entails applying efficient support techniques. You should begin by using steel rebar, which offers tensile toughness and aids stop cracking. Lay the rebar in a grid pattern, seeing to it it rises using spacers to keep proper coverage. Additionally, take into consideration using cable mesh for added assistance, particularly in areas subject to hefty tons. Don't fail to remember to connect the rebar crossways firmly with cord. For bigger foundations, fiber support can boost durability, lowering the danger of contraction cracks. Always adhere to local building ordinance and standards to make certain compliance. By applying these reinforcement techniques, you'll greatly enhance your foundation's toughness and durability, laying a strong foundation for your framework.
Curing Process Basics
To assure your concrete foundation cures correctly, it is essential to preserve adequate moisture and temperature conditions quickly after pouring. Start by covering the surface area with a wet cloth or plastic sheeting to preserve wetness. This maintains the concrete hydrated, preventing splits and making certain toughness. You ought to likewise monitor the temperature level; excellent treating problems are between 50 ° F and 90 ° F. If it's also warm, haze the surface consistently to stop rapid evaporation. For winter, consider utilizing insulating coverings to keep heat. Goal for a treating period of at the very least 7 days, as this is crucial for ideal toughness advancement. By complying with these finest practices, you'll enhance your structure's sturdiness and durability, guaranteeing structural stability for several years ahead.

Effective Drain Solutions
Normal examinations can reveal issues like drainage issues that could jeopardize your concrete structure's security. To avoid water build-up, ensure your seamless gutters and downspouts direct water far from the foundation. Installing French drains can successfully redirect surface area and groundwater, lowering stress on your foundation wall surfaces. In addition, grading the soil around your home assists assure that water moves away, as opposed to merging near your foundation.Consider making use of sump pumps in areas prone to flooding, as they proactively get rid of excess water. Consistently examine for blockages in water drainage systems and clear them without delay. You'll shield your structure's honesty and longevity by taking these positive measures. Bear in mind, effective drain services are essential for preserving a strong, sturdy concrete structure.
